The perennial popularity of antique dolls suggests a warm reception among doll lovers and coloring book fans for this charming collection of yesteryear's beauties. Thirty full-page, ready-to-color illustrations depict actual 19th-century dolls in authentic period costumes. Included are captivating Jumeau dolls with long, curly tresses; a Bru lady doll with a fashionable hat and high-necked dress, c. 1870; a French fashion bride of the 1870s; a French walking doll with feathered hat, c. 1880; an engaging, wide-eyed, bisque "googlie"; a Simon and Halbig, as well as a Kestner doll-both with long hair; a Francois Gautier-type lady doll; and many more. Six of the dolls are shown in full color on the covers.
Dover Original. 30 full-page black-and-white illustrations. Six color illustrations on covers. Captions. 32pp. 8 1/4" x 11". Saddlewired. September 2000, Paperbd.
